Solarwinds Service Desk is a cloud-based IT service management platform that streamlines the process of handling IT service requests, asset management, and incident management. It is primarily used to improve IT service delivery and support operations.

What is MCP?

Model Context Protocol lets AI tools call external capabilities securely through a single URL. This bundle groups tools behind an MCP endpoint that many clients can use.
